Civic Duty Gunsmithing is a family-friendly shop run by Jerry Slauter, an AGI master-level gunsmith with nearly a lifetime invested in metalworking and precision. Recently retired from 26 years teaching Industrial Technology, Slauter brings serious credentials to firearms repair, restoration, and customization.
The shop focuses on what matters: preserving the art of detail-oriented craftsmanship. Whether you're bringing in a turn-of-the-century relic or a latest-generation precision rifle, the work gets done right.
Optic Services - Boresighting to true zero ($65) - Scope mounting with ring lapping ($70–$110) - RMR/BO-MAR cuts ($225–$400) - Night sight installation ($50–$100) - Drill and tap ($35/hole)
Rifle Work - Headspace checks ($50) - Chambering (from $200) - Barrel cut and crown ($125) - Muzzle threading ($100–$125) - Glass bedding (from $100) - Trigger work, dovetail cuts, accuracy packages - Full AR-15, AR-10, and AR-9 support
Pistol & Revolver Services - Slide fitting and trigger work - Hammer/sear stoning - Stainless polishing (from $100) - Glock manual safety install ($89) - Hand-fitted parts swaps
Additional Work - Shotgun repair, restoration, and tuning (new or old) - Metal refinishing: parkerizing, traditional rust bluing, powder coating, bead blast - Machining services: fixturing, milling, thread chasing - Firearm transfers: $25 each (up to 4), then $20 each additional
